In 2013, Target Corporation was hacked. Credit and debit card data of 40 million of Target’s customers were exposed. Hackers reportedly infiltrated Target via access from an outside vendor, Fazio Mechanical. Often, CIOs will deal with outside vendors who ask for access or need to access some of their company’s data.
